What Is Bone Broth and Exactly How Is It Made?



Bone broth is a nutrient-rich fluid made by simmering bones and connective tissues from pets, often combined with veggies, natural herbs, and spices. To make it, you start by choosing premium bones, like those from beef, chicken, or fish. Location the bones in a huge pot, cover them with water, and add a dash of vinegar. This helps attract out the minerals. Next off, throw in your favorite vegetables, such as carrots, celery, and onions, in addition to herbs like thyme or bay leaves for taste. Bring it to a boil, then decrease the warm and allow it simmer for numerous hours-- occasionally as much as 24! The longer it simmers, the richer and more delicious it ends up being. After cooking, strain the liquid from the solids, and you have actually obtained a scrumptious, nourishing broth ready to enjoy. Use it in soups, stews, or drink it warm for a comforting drink.

Sodium Web Content Worries





When considering bone broth while pregnant, it's critical to focus on greater than simply allergic reactions and level of sensitivities; salt content is another vital factor. While bone broth can be nutritious, it typically includes greater salt degrees, which could not be suitable for expectant mommies (bone broth for infants). Taking in excessive salt can bring about raised blood stress and fluid retention, potentially complicating your maternity. It is essential to check your consumption, especially if you have pre-existing hypertension or various other health and wellness concerns. You could desire to select lower-sodium alternatives or thin down the broth with water to maintain levels in check. Constantly pay attention to your body and consult your medical care provider concerning your salt needs while pregnant to make certain you're making the ideal options for you and your infant.

Can Bone Broth Be Icy for Later Usage?



Yes, you can ice up bone broth for later use. Simply let it trendy, after that pour it right into closed containers or fridge freezer bags. It'll stay fresh for as much as six months, making dish preparation easier!
